【2画面ファイラ】 内骨格 Part1 【Python拡張】at SOFTWARE
【2画面ファイラ】 内骨格 Part1 【Python拡張】 - 暇つぶし2ch298:名無しさん@お腹いっぱい。
08/09/21 01:27:09 2yccBCk90
>>287
こんな感じ

class sorter_ByNameRev:
def __call__( self, left, right ):
if left.isdir() and not right.isdir() :
return -1
elif not left.isdir() and right.isdir() :
return 1
return -cmp( left.name.lower(), right.name.lower() )
class sorter_ByExtRev:
def __call__( self, left, right ):
if left.isdir() and not right.isdir() :
return -1
elif not left.isdir() and right.isdir() :
return 1
cmp_result_ext = cmp( os.path.splitext(left.name)[1].lower(), os.path.splitext(right.name)[1].lower() )
if cmp_result_ext : return cmp_result_ext
return -cmp( left.name.lower(), right.name.lower() )



次ページ
続きを表示
1を表示
最新レス表示
レスジャンプ
類似スレ一覧
スレッドの検索
話題のニュース
おまかせリスト
オプション
しおりを挟む
スレッドに書込
スレッドの一覧
暇つぶし2ch